As we detailed yesterday, the Switch Online service allows you to take your Nintendo Account to another Switch, log in with your info, and access your eShop games. Nintendo says you can only play these games in one location at a time, but there's actually an easy workaround for that. Simply load up the game you want on your primary Switch and start playing, then disconnect the wifi on your Switch. Then head over to the secondary Switch, log in, and you're good to go! As long as you don't reconnect to wifi on the primary Switch, you can play the same game in two places.
